Output 68d600f1a8f0ac74ef44020325f9cf5d76f8f6e2ae10b865015fc204aafa0429:3

value
666252
script pubkey
OP_0 OP_PUSHBYTES_20 36de07379ffff5c2a8f1a939f8f7ec7c87647421
address
bc1qxm0qwdulll6u92834yul3alv0jrkgappntjpjf
transaction
68d600f1a8f0ac74ef44020325f9cf5d76f8f6e2ae10b865015fc204aafa0429
confirmations
127580
spent
true